Introduction to Financial Reporting Model
Data Framework (DF) is a data life cycle framework that provides the Temenos Transact customers to realise the huge potential value of the transactional data generated by Temenos Transact. This is achieved by using a read-only Dimensional (DIMal) database optimised for near real-time predictive analytics and modelling tools.
DF provides the infrastructure to create and maintain a read-only database in near real time using Extract Transform and Load (ETL) process, to ensure a database which is optimised for reporting. It also provides the ability to design and execute queries against the read-only database. It leverages the Temenos Transact Interaction and Integration frameworks, so that the data is available in near real-time. Financial Reporting Model
The Financial Reporting model (DZ) is a business domain and is available from 201612. This model is packaged under the Temenos DZ module and is licenced together with the Data Framework Reporting Model (DF) module.
This model is designed specifically for the purposes of querying the information of general ledger movements, all necessary information to produce financial reports and queries. This includes a full history of journal movements, contract and general ledger balances, with capability to drill down from general ledger to the underlying movement or contract balance. The model also includes the necessary infrastructure to support the update of the read-only database in near-real time, and the ability to define and execute enquiries in the read-only database.
Understanding the Components of the DZ Module
The DZ module consists of the following components.
- The Dimensional (DIMal) data model.
- A set of Integration Framework (IF) events.
- A set of transformation rules (execute transform and load).
- Query and report.
